Analysis

In 2023, nutrient balance — cropland nitrogen use efficiency in Bahrain stood at 27.77 %.

The figure is up 1.9% on the previous year and up 837.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, nutrient balance — cropland nitrogen use efficiency in Bahrain peaked at 115.79 % in 1977 and was at its lowest, 2.73 %, in 2014.

That places Bahrain 169th out of 201 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 88.29 % 80.65 % 94.85 % 9
1970s 89.82 % 66.57 % 115.79 % 10
1980s 24.24 % 7.12 % 57.32 % 10
1990s 19.91 % 12.11 % 36.78 % 10
2000s 10.97 % 4.11 % 32.09 % 10
2010s 12.52 % 2.73 % 28.24 % 10
2020s 25.44 % 22.1 % 27.77 % 4

The Cropland Nutrient balance domain contains information on the flows of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ium from mineral fertilizer, manure applied, atmospheric deposition, crop removal, and biological fixation over cropland and per unit area of cropland. The flows are aggregated to total inputs and total outputs, from which the overall nutrient balance and nutrient use efficiency on cropland are calculated. Statistics are disseminated in units of tonnes and in kg/ha, as appropriate. Nutrient use efficiency is expressed as a fraction (%).
